An asylum seeker named Ali Sadeghfar was arrested at a contentious migrant camp in East Sussex after it was revealed he was wanted in Germany on suspicion of rape. Sadeghfar, an Iranian national, had been residing at Crowborough Training Camp following his arrival in the UK by boat. The National Crime Agency took him into custody earlier this month, highlighting the complexities of handling asylum seekers and criminal investigations simultaneously.
